John J. Engemann is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ology and Clinical Biochem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, John J. Engemann has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 2.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Infectious Diseases, 11 papers in Epidemiology and 7 papers in Clinical Biochemistry. Recurrent topics in John J. Engemann's work include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(10 papers),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(7 papers) and Infective Endocarditis Diagnosis and Management (6 papers). John J. Engemann is often cited by papers focused on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(10 papers),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(7 papers) and Infective Endocarditis Diagnosis and Management (6 papers). John J. Engemann collaborates with scholars based in United States and Argentina. John J. Engemann's co-authors include Keith S. Kaye, Vance G. Fowler, Daniel J. Sexton, Yehuda Carmeli, Sara E. Cosgrove, Jane Briggs, Melissa Bronstein, Vivian H. Chu, G. Ralph Corey and L. Barth Reller and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, American Journal of Respiratory and Critical Care Medicine and Clinical Infectious Diseases.
